What is Richards Free Library?

Richards Free Library is a nonprofit institution situated in Newport, New Hampshire, specifically at 58 North Main Street, 03773. Its primary mission is to aid individuals in their pursuit of trustworthy information, self-education, expanded comprehension, and intellectual delight. This is accomplished by offering an array of resources, services, and programs. The library serves as a hub for the assembly of people and ideas, aiming to enrich both the individuals and the community. Additionally, the Library Arts Center within Richards Free Library functions as a regional cultural and arts center, allowing residents and visitors to observe, learn, and participate in various artistic activities. Established in 1967, the library houses a team of 20 dedicated employees.

What are the reviews and ratings of this charity?

Charity Navigator Rating: 77%, Three-Star out of Four Star rating.

Richards Free Library has received a Three-Star rating from Charity Navigator, reflecting an overall score of 77%. This rating is based solely on a comprehensive evaluation of the organization's accountability and financial health, indicating a strong commitment to transparency and responsible management of resources.

The library exhibits several strengths, such as having a fully independent board with 100% of its members meeting this criterion. Additionally, there are no reported material diversions of assets, and the library has implemented robust policies regarding conflicts of interest and document retention. Their effective allocation of resources is evident, with a program expense ratio of 86.99%, suggesting that a significant portion of funds is directed towards fulfilling their mission.

While the organization shows commendable financial practices, the single beacon score means that there is limited insight into other areas like impact and service delivery. Despite this limitation, the library's strong financial accountability and governance practices are positive indicators of its operational integrity.

Is Richards Free Library legitimate?

Richards Free Library is a legitimate nonprofit organization registered as a 501(c)(3) entity. Richards Free Library submitted a form 990, which is a tax form used by tax-exempt organizations in the U.S., indicating its operational transparency and adherence to regulatory requirements. Donations to this organization are tax deductible.


Heare are some key statistics you may want to consider:

Executive Compensation: $0
Professional Fundraising Fees: $0
Other Salaries and Wages: $360,349
